SHEEP WORRYING MENACE

— COUNCIL ASKED TQ T4KE JIAND The menace to the distriet caused by stray dogs Worrying sheep was the subject of a letter received. from the Levin branch of Federated Farmers at the monthiy meeting of the Horowhenua County ■Pouncil yesterday. The letter pffer- . ed full support to the council in any measure, liowever strict, which. would help rid the distriet Qf pseIgss dogg. '""Tliere.can be 110 doubt' that the worrying is done in - the main hy useless dogs from the toypi and surrounding * d|stricts," stated the letter. "it is very. seldom that a working farm dog will reyert tp these wild habits." In the executive's opinion any stray dogs that are unclaimed, or whose owneys refuse tp admit ownership when approached fpf'registratiprij should he destroyed "im'mediately. Of late sheep worrying had become more prevalent, said thq chairman, Mr. A. J. Gimblett. Thqre had heen two. very serious eases of worfying recently. Registration of the dogs would not solyp the problem, was thq opinion of Cr.^A. M. Colquhoun. The people who did not tie Up their dogs were the ohes to blame. Some farmers tock the matter into their own hands and shot all stray dogs, stated Cr. J. D. Aitchir son. "While the council \Vas entirely in sympa^hy with any organisation which could provide a solution tp * the stray dog m&iance, and would welcome any suggestions, at the present time nothing more could be done. The council is more than anxious to stand behind any movement that would tend towards improvement.
